一位群友说:德国工程师写的程序像写“诗”!如何写一首好“诗”的4点建议
今天一早,一位群友发了一张德国工程师的程序截图。在10个”博途之友“交流群讨论的过程中,一位群友说:程序写的像诗一样。
Zui近3年,我都在研究PLC程序标准化,对youxiu的程序有一些认识,从以下4点来看youxiu的PLC程序,有感而发,供大家参考。
一看:程序架构,有层级的程序架构
很多工程师设计了程序架构,只是基于功能划分,还需要层级的划分,包括数据层级划分。
二看:有意义的命名规则
驼峰法是IT的通用命名规则,也是西门子等厂家的推荐规则。不建议大家使用中文命名。
三看:清晰的功能块结构
功能块部分,大部分工程师做的都不太好。
1、建议使用SCL语言,不要用LAD,SCL语言利于高效编程。
2、用REGION,把程序模块化。
四看:一致而直观的界面
好的HMI界面是基于模板和面板技术来构建的,而不是拼凑起来的。
youxiu的程序都是在搭积木。。。